The story of solar energy begins in 1839 with the work of French physicist Edmond Becquerel.
Although solar panel production became feasible in the 1960s and 1970s. Technology was still too expensive for most people at the time. To lower the price of solar energy, researchers kept working on new technologies. The first P-N junction cell was created after semiconductors gained popularity.
In the United States, the federal Solar Energy Research Institute (now the National Renewable Energy Laboratory) was created in 1977 to drive innovation in photovoltaics. Germany and Japan also emerged as early leaders in solar technology and manufacturing during this period.
The 1970s oil crises fueled interest in substitute energy, spurring solar research and development. By the 1980s and 90s, commercial solar panels became more accessible. Improvements in efficiency and reductions in cost made this possible. These advancements paved the way for widespread adoption.
As NASA pushed further out into the solar system in the 1970s, photovoltaics became the standard power system for its spacecraft and remains so today. Back on Earth, solar energy technology continued to advance gradually through the mid-20th century but remained uncompetitive with cheap, readily available fossil fuels.
